About Aalo Atomics

Aalo Atomics is pioneering a new era in clean energy with factory-fabricated microreactors designed to deliver affordable, scalable, and reliable nuclear power. Our mission is to make nuclear energy globally accessible, starting with the Aalo-1, a 10 MWe reactor leveraging cutting-edge safety, modularity, and efficiency. Based in Austin, TX, we’re rapidly growing as we work to deploy the world’s first fleet of advanced microreactors. Join us and help revolutionize energy for a sustainable future.


About the role

As an Electrical Technician, you’ll play a hands-on role fabricating and assembling high-reliability electromechanical systems critical to the next generation of clean energy. This is a fast-paced, high-standards environment where your expertise will directly impact the performance and safety of our technology.

What you'll doElectrical Assembly & Fabrication
  • Build and assemble high-quality electromechanical components and wire harnesses
  • Follow mechanical drawings and GD&T standards to ensure precise construction
  • Use standard tools and electronics equipment (e.g., DMMs, oscilloscopes, programmable power supplies) for builds and testing
Documentation & Process Execution
  • Read and interpret technical documentation, including schematics and work instructions
  • Document all work clearly and accurately in ERP systems and internal platforms (e.g., Outlook, shop floor systems)
  • Assist with first-run production processes and support process improvement efforts
Testing & Quality
  • Run tests in HASS/HALT and thermal chambers, report results with precision
  • Perform verification of electrical assemblies and identify issues in design or vendor quality
  • Maintain high standards of cleanliness and accuracy, contributing to a quality-first culture
QualificationsRequired
  • High school diploma or equivalency certificate
  • 2+ years of professional experience with electronics tools and test equipment
  • 2+ years of hands-on experience using mechanical and/or electronics hand tools
  • Strong ability to read and interpret engineering documentation
Preferred
  • Associate’s degree in electronics, electromechanical technology, or related field
  • 6+ years of experience working with wire harnesses or flight hardware in production environments
  • Familiarity with fast-paced manufacturing or aerospace environments
  • Strong attention to detail, self-directed work ethic, and excellent teamwork and communication skills
Physical
  • Ability to stand for long periods, climb ladders, bend, stoop, stretch, and lift up to 25 lbs unassisted
  • Must be able to distinguish wire and connector color codes
